The size of Hurstville is approximately 4.1 square kilometres. It has 19 parks covering nearly 4.6% of total area. The population of Hurstville in 2011 was 26,040 people. By 2016 the population was 29,814 showing a population growth of 14.5%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Hurstville is 20-29 years. Households in Hurstville are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Hurstville work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 57.8% of the homes in Hurstville were owner-occupied compared with 51.6% in 2016.
Hurstville has 16,009 properties.
